|
|
|
roeptisa
|
Buenas,
Quería saber si existe alguna extensión de gvsig Mobile para mejorar la precisión del GPS en campo. Así como en arcap se encuentra la extensión GPScorrect, a ver si hay algo parecido para gvsig Mobile. Muchas Gracias. Saludos, |
|
Juan Guillermo Jordán Aldasoro
|
Se prevé incluir la funcionalidad de almacenar en formato RINEX datos
del GPS que permiten corregir diferencialmente en postproceso. De momento no está planificado desarrollar el software para la corrección en postproceso, aunque hay varios programas que lo hacen a partir de ficheros RINEX, como GPStk [1][2]. Hasta aquí la respuesta a tu pregunta. Lo que viene después son unas reflexiones y dudas que tengo sobre este tema, acerca de las cuales agradecería comentarios / sugerencias, si algún usuario de GPS de precisión / profesional de la geodesia lo lee. Como desarrollador no-usuario de un GPS de precisión tipo Trimble me surgen algunas dudas acerca de cómo implementar este almacenamiento en formato RINEX. A lo mejor los usuarios de ArcPad y otros programas similares me pueden dar ideas. Me explico. En la hoja técnica de la extensión GPScorrect que mencionas dice que se almacenan metadatos junto con las posiciones. Yo entiendo que esto puede hacerse almacenando en RINEX, donde esos metadatos serían los observables GPS, esto es, pseudorrangos, fase de portadora, etc. La duda que tengo es la siguiente. Un usuario sale a tomar datos y genera un shape de unos 30 vértices (no corregidos). Si se almacenan los "metadatos" para toda la sesión, digamos por ejemplo una hora de recolección de datos, entonces tenemos un shape de 30 vértices por un lado, y una traza de unos 3600 puntos con metadatos por otro lado. El usuario podría corregir la traza con cierto software, por ejemplo GPStk, abrir la traza corregida en gvSIG y comparar con el shape de 30 vértices con la traza de 3600 puntos corregidos. Podría buscar qué vértices coinciden con puntos de la traza por su marca temporal y corregirlos. Lo anterior puede funcionar pero es algo trabajoso para el usuario. Además no funciona para vértices promediados, es decir, si para cada punto del shape yo estuve 1 minuto parado promediando posiciones, entonces tendría que identificar qué puntos de mi traza corregida corresponden al punto promediado, y volver a promediarlos. Me pregunto si sería una mejor idea asociar un fichero RINEX a cada vértice almacenado durante la sesión. En este caso sí se podría asociar el fichero Rinex #1 al vértice 1, que si se trata de un vértice promediado contendrá decenas de puntos que después se podrán corregir y promediar de nuevo. De este modo descartamos todos los puntos de la sesión que no interesan, ¿me explico? A ver si algún usuario me explica cuál suele ser la forma de trabajar en postproceso, aunque sospecho que la aplicación (ArcPad y la extensión GPScorrect) debe gestionar todo esto de forma transparente y el usuario ni se entera. Saludos Juangui [1] http://www.gpstk.org [2] http://www.gpstk.org/pub/Documentation/GPSTkPublications/Salazar-D-gpstk-high-accuracy.pdf roeptisa escribió: > Buenas, > > Quería saber si existe alguna extensión de gvsig Mobile para mejorar la > precisión del GPS en campo. > Así como en arcap se encuentra la extensión GPScorrect, a ver si hay algo > parecido para gvsig Mobile. > > Muchas Gracias. > > Saludos, > _______________________________________________ gvSIG_desarrolladores mailing list [hidden email] http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ores |
||||||||||||||||
|
Miguel Montesinos
|
Hola,
Además de todas las consideraciones que hace Juangui, que por cierto estaría fenomenal que fueran comentadas por los que teneis esta necesidad o habeis planteado la cuestión ;-) , en la versión 0.2 de gvSIG Mobile hay incluidas unas mejoras específicas para poder aprovechar la mejora de precisión que ofrecen receptores GPS con precisión StarFire, de la familia NavCom [1], que llega a una precisión de 10 cm. No es lo mismo que el post-proceso, pero es una muy buena solución en tiempo real. [1] http://www.navcomtech.com/StarFire/ Saludos --------------------------------------------- Miguel Montesinos Director Técnico PRODEVELOP, S.L. mmontesinos [en] prodevelop [punto] es www.prodevelop.es > -----Mensaje original----- > De: [hidden email] [mailto:gvsig_desarrolladores- > [hidden email]] En nombre de Juan Guillermo Jordán Aldasoro > Enviado el: jueves, 15 de octubre de 2009 12:40 > Para: Lista de Desarrolladores de gvSIG > Asunto: Re: [Gvsig_desarrolladores] CORRECION DIFERENCIAL GPS > > Se prevé incluir la funcionalidad de almacenar en formato RINEX datos > del GPS que permiten corregir diferencialmente en postproceso. De > momento no está planificado desarrollar el software para la corrección > en postproceso, aunque hay varios programas que lo hacen a partir de > ficheros RINEX, como GPStk [1][2]. > > Hasta aquí la respuesta a tu pregunta. Lo que viene después son unas > reflexiones y dudas que tengo sobre este tema, acerca de las cuales > agradecería comentarios / sugerencias, si algún usuario de GPS de > precisión / profesional de la geodesia lo lee. > > > Como desarrollador no-usuario de un GPS de precisión tipo Trimble me > surgen algunas dudas acerca de cómo implementar este almacenamiento en > formato RINEX. A lo mejor los usuarios de ArcPad y otros programas > similares me pueden dar ideas. Me explico. En la hoja técnica de la > extensión GPScorrect que mencionas dice que se almacenan metadatos junto > con las posiciones. Yo entiendo que esto puede hacerse almacenando en > RINEX, donde esos metadatos serían los observables GPS, esto es, > pseudorrangos, fase de portadora, etc. > > La duda que tengo es la siguiente. Un usuario sale a tomar datos y > genera un shape de unos 30 vértices (no corregidos). Si se almacenan los > "metadatos" para toda la sesión, digamos por ejemplo una hora de > recolección de datos, entonces tenemos un shape de 30 vértices por un > lado, y una traza de unos 3600 puntos con metadatos por otro lado. El > usuario podría corregir la traza con cierto software, por ejemplo GPStk, > abrir la traza corregida en gvSIG y comparar con el shape de 30 vértices > con la traza de 3600 puntos corregidos. Podría buscar qué vértices > coinciden con puntos de la traza por su marca temporal y corregirlos. > > Lo anterior puede funcionar pero es algo trabajoso para el usuario. > Además no funciona para vértices promediados, es decir, si para cada > punto del shape yo estuve 1 minuto parado promediando posiciones, > entonces tendría que identificar qué puntos de mi traza corregida > corresponden al punto promediado, y volver a promediarlos. Me pregunto > si sería una mejor idea asociar un fichero RINEX a cada vértice > almacenado durante la sesión. En este caso sí se podría asociar el > fichero Rinex #1 al vértice 1, que si se trata de un vértice promediado > contendrá decenas de puntos que después se podrán corregir y promediar > de nuevo. De este modo descartamos todos los puntos de la sesión que no > interesan, ¿me explico? > > A ver si algún usuario me explica cuál suele ser la forma de trabajar en > postproceso, aunque sospecho que la aplicación (ArcPad y la extensión > GPScorrect) debe gestionar todo esto de forma transparente y el usuario > ni se entera. > > Saludos > Juangui > > [1] http://www.gpstk.org > [2] > http://www.gpstk.org/pub/Documentation/GPSTkPublications/Salazar-D-gpstk-high- > accuracy.pdf > > roeptisa escribió: > > Buenas, > > > > Quería saber si existe alguna extensión de gvsig Mobile para mejorar la > > precisión del GPS en campo. > > Así como en arcap se encuentra la extensión GPScorrect, a ver si hay algo > > parecido para gvsig Mobile. > > > > Muchas Gracias. > > > > Saludos, > > > > _______________________________________________ > gvSIG_desarrolladores mailing list > [hidden email] > http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ores gvSIG_desarrolladores mailing list [hidden email] http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ores |
||||||||||||||||
|
Jose A. Jimenez Berni
|
Creo que una opción interesante para mejorar la precisión de los GPS de bajo coste sería la posibilidad de introducir al GPS correcciones diferenciales en tiempo real, en formato RTCM, a través del puerto serie. La mayoría de los GPS permiten esta opción aunque pocos programas lo soportan.
La idea sería implementar en gvSIG Mobile un pequeño cliente del protocolo NTRIP [1] que permita conectar a alguno de los servidores de correcciones RTCM disponibles [2]. El cliente descargaría las correcciones y las envía a través del propio puerto del GPS o bien a través de un puerto serie secundario. A nivel de PC existen programas que realizan esa tarea, como el GNSS Internet Radio [3], y muchos GPS comerciales de gama alta ya incorporan la posibilidad de conectarse a servidores de este tipo. [1] http://igs.bkg.bund.de/index_ntrip.htm [2] http://www.ntrip.org/ [3] http://igs.bkg.bund.de/ntrip/ntrip_down.htm Saludos, Berni 2009/10/20 Miguel Montesinos <[hidden email]> Hola, -- =================================================== Jose A. Jimenez-Berni QuantaLab - Instituto de Agricultura Sostenible (IAS) Consejo Superior de Investigaciones Científica (CSIC) Alameda del Obispo S/N 14004 - Córdoba Phone: +34 957499258 Fax: +34 957499252 email: [hidden email] / [hidden email] web: http://quantalab.ias.csic.es _______________________________________________ gvSIG_desarrolladores mailing list [hidden email] http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ores |
||||||||||||||||
|
Juan Guillermo Jordán Aldasoro
|
Some javascript/style in this post has been disabled (why?)
Hola, pues esa funcionalidad sí que está prevista para gvSIG Mobile 1.0
y testeada a nivel experimental.Como tú dices, la contrapartida es que hay muy pocos GPS conectables a una PDA que lo permitan, si por conectables se entiende que tengan bluetooth o un medio de conexión por tarjeta de memoria. Yo conozco uno y ni siquiera estoy seguro 100% de que lo permita (Wintec WBT-300 G-Rays I) porque no lo he testeado y el fabricante no me contesta. Hay opciones USB y RS232 pero entonces necesitarás un conversor, que viene a costar más que el GPS, pero bueno, es una opción ;) Juangui Jose A. Jimenez Berni escribió: Creo que una opción interesante para mejorar la precisión de los GPS de bajo coste sería la posibilidad de introducir al GPS correcciones diferenciales en tiempo real, en formato RTCM, a través del puerto serie. La mayoría de los GPS permiten esta opción aunque pocos programas lo soportan. _______________________________________________ gvSIG_desarrolladores mailing list [hidden email] http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ores |
||||||||||||||||
|
Juan Guillermo Jordán Aldasoro
|
In reply to this post
by Jose A. Jimenez Berni
Some javascript/style in this post has been disabled (why?)
Como también dices, los GPS de alta gama lo permiten, aunque ya no
podemos hablar de una solución de bajo coste :)Jose A. Jimenez Berni escribió: Creo que una opción interesante para mejorar la precisión de los GPS de bajo coste sería la posibilidad de introducir al GPS correcciones diferenciales en tiempo real, en formato RTCM, a través del puerto serie. La mayoría de los GPS permiten esta opción aunque pocos programas lo soportan. _______________________________________________ gvSIG_desarrolladores mailing list [hidden email] http://listserv.gva.es/cgi-bin/mailman/listinfo/gvsig_desarrolladores |
||||||||||||||||
| Free Embeddable Forum Powered by Nabble | Help |